The Role
To support all the activities Genmab is looking to expand with a new IT QA Senior Manager.
As IT QA Senior Manager, you will contribute to establishing and maintaining the “Genmab Standard” for the oversight of computerized systems and be supporting several IT validation projects.
You will be part of a global QA team and report to the Team Lead IT QA. This role will be based out of our Utrecht, NL Office.
Resonsibilities
The responsibilities of the IT QA Senior Manager will include, but are not limited to:
- Ensuring compliance with applicable regulatory requirements of the computerized systems that are or will be implemented
- Quality oversight, review, and approval of validation processes and validation activities performed in Genmab across the regulated parts of the organization
- Identifying and implementing improvements to the IT system life cycle and validation processes to ensure a pragmatic and risk-based validation approach
- Support IT in establishing and maintaining an IT infrastructure qualified for intended use i.e. in supporting validated systems.
- Securing compliance with internal procedures and external GxP demands
- Preparing computerized system risk and regulatory impact assessments and other evaluations, e.g. periodic reviews
- Coordinating validation activities in compliance with corporate policy, local procedures, and regulatory expectations.
- Reviewing and assisting in developing departmental standard operating procedures (SOPs) and validation programs
- Supporting vendor qualification activities
- Supporting infrastructure qualification/computerized system validation projects as allocated
Requirements
- 5-10 years of IT QA Management experience within the Life Science industry
- Documented experience with implementing and validating IT systems, as well as supporting and maintaining existing IT systems keeping them in a validated state
- Experience with cloud-based software, internally hosted systems, and qualification of IT infrastructure, e.g. as part of an ITIL program
- A Degree preferably in Natural Science combined with an IT education.
- Excellent English communication skills, both written and spoken
